Jaisingh Maravi of Bharatiya Janta Party won the Jaitp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ency in Madhya Pradesh in the 2023 state assembly election, securing 107,698 votes (53.70% vote share). The runner-up was Uma Dhurvey (Indian National Congress) with 75,993 votes.

A total of 11 candidates contested this assembly seat. State Assembly elections elect Members of the Legislative Assembly (MLAs) using India's First-Past-The-Post (FPTP) system, and the party or alliance winning a majority of seats forms the state government. Constituency Details
  • State: Madhya Pradesh
  • Constituency: Jaitpur
  • Constituency Number: 85
  • District: Shahdol
  • Total Contestants: 11
  • Election Year: 2023
  • Election Type: Vidhan Sabha (State Assembly)
Position Candidate Name Votes Votes% Party
1 Jaisingh Maravi 107698 53.70% Bharatiya Janta Party
2 Uma Dhurvey 75993 37.90% Indian National Congress
3 Bharat Singh Oladi 5090 2.50% Gondvana Gantantra Party
4 Katahura 2098 1.10% Aazad Samaj Party (Kanshi Ram)
5 Shivprasad Singh Pavle 1431 0.70% Independent
6 Paw Bheemsen Singh 1249 0.60% Peoples Party Of India (Democratic)
7 Visheshar Singh Paw 993 0.50% Samajwadi Party
8 Vikram Baiga 668 0.30% Vindhya Janta Party
9 Kajal Bai 667 0.30% Vastavik Bharat Party
10 Narayan Singh Kushram 653 0.30% Bahujan Gondwana Party
11 Phatebahadur 551 0.30% Bhartiya Shakti Chetna Party
